Senior Associate, Revenue Operations
Cvent
Overview: We are seeking a Senior Associate, Revenue Operations under the Global Sales Operations department. This role will require someone who can partner with various stakeholders to represent Sales and collaborate effectively on cross-functional projects. As a Senior Associate in Revenue Operations, you will both support Sales on inbound requests & resolution of contract errors, and focus on managing the rhythm of the business, including Sales communication, meetings, & incentives. If you thrive on digging into all the details of a problem & solving them, creating process documentation, and checking tasks off your to-do lists, this role is for you! In This Role, You Will: Become an expert on all EC and HC Sales processes to support inbound questions from the Sales team via Slack (#spot-help) and email (JIRA). Own and manage multiple Sales team meetings, such as quarterly award ceremonies and various monthly team meetings, including sourcing content, creating decks, scheduling meetings, and preparing speakers appropriately. Assist in the preparation & execution of larger company events, including SKO & CCUS. Create and send out various forms of Sales team communication, including quarterly newsletters, weekly newsletters for different departments, & ad hoc communication as needed. Manage and track the use of the annual Sales Incentive & Engagement budget by department, ensuring appropriate approvals are received & tickets are submitted, and collaborate with Finance for any approvals needed for Sales spend. Plan & manage Sales incentive outings and ad hoc events. Manage HQ Sales seating & email distribution lists.
